diff --git a/src/com/android/launcher3/widget/WidgetTableRow.java b/src/com/android/launcher3/widget/WidgetTableRow.java
new file mode 100644
index 0000000..a5312ce
--- /dev/null
+++ b/src/com/android/launcher3/widget/WidgetTableRow.java
@@ -0,0 +1,90 @@
+/*
+ * Copyright (C) 2024 The Android Open Source Project
+ *
+ * Licensed under the Apache License, Version 2.0 (the "License");
+ * you may not use this file except in compliance with the License.
+ * You may obtain a copy of the License at
+ *
+ *      http://www.apache.org/licenses/LICENSE-2.0
+ *
+ * Unless required by applicable law or agreed to in writing, software
+ * distributed under the License is distributed on an "AS IS" BASIS,
+ * WITHOUT WARRANTIES OR CONDITIONS OF ANY KIND, either express or implied.
+ * See the License for the specific language governing permissions and
+ * limitations under the License.
+ */
+
+package com.android.launcher3.widget;
+
+import android.content.Context;
+import android.util.AttributeSet;
+import android.widget.TableRow;
+
+/**
+ * A row of {@link WidgetCell}s that can be displayed in a table.
+ */
+public class WidgetTableRow extends TableRow implements WidgetCell.PreviewReadyListener {
+    private int mNumOfReadyCells;
+    private int mNumOfCells;
+    private int mResizeDelay;
+
+    public WidgetTableRow(Context context) {
+        super(context);
+    }
+    public WidgetTableRow(Context context, AttributeSet attrs) {
+        super(context, attrs);
+    }
+
+    @Override
+    public void onPreviewAvailable() {
+        mNumOfReadyCells++;
+
+        // Once all previews are loaded, find max visible height and adjust the preview containers.
+        if (mNumOfReadyCells == mNumOfCells) {
+            resize();
+        }
+    }
+
+    private void resize() {
+        int previewHeight = 0;
+        // get the maximum height of each widget preview
+        for (int i = 0; i < getChildCount(); i++) {
+            WidgetCell widgetCell = (WidgetCell) getChildAt(i);
+            previewHeight = Math.max(widgetCell.getPreviewContentHeight(), previewHeight);
+        }
+        if (mResizeDelay > 0) {
+            postDelayed(() -> setAlpha(1f), mResizeDelay);
+        }
+        if (previewHeight > 0) {
+            for (int i = 0; i < getChildCount(); i++) {
+                WidgetCell widgetCell = (WidgetCell) getChildAt(i);
+                widgetCell.setParentAlignedPreviewHeight(previewHeight);
+                widgetCell.postDelayed(widgetCell::requestLayout, mResizeDelay);
+            }
+        }
+    }
+
+    @Override
+    protected void onLayout(boolean changed, int l, int t, int r, int b) {
+        super.onLayout(changed, l, t, r, b);
+    }
+
+    /**
+     * Sets up the row to display the provided number of numOfCells.
+     *
+     * @param numOfCells    number of numOfCells in the row
+     * @param resizeDelayMs time to wait in millis before making any layout size adjustments e.g. we
+     *                      want to wait for list expand collapse animation before resizing the
+     *                      cell previews.
+     */
+    public void setupRow(int numOfCells, int resizeDelayMs) {
+        mNumOfCells = numOfCells;
+        mNumOfReadyCells = 0;
+
+        mResizeDelay = resizeDelayMs;
+        // For delayed resize, reveal contents only after resize is done.
+        if (mResizeDelay > 0) {
+            setAlpha(0);
+        }
+    }
+}

diff --git a/src/com/android/launcher3/widget/picker/WidgetsListItemAnimator.java b/src/com/android/launcher3/widget/picker/WidgetsListItemAnimator.java
new file mode 100644
index 0000000..854700f
--- /dev/null
+++ b/src/com/android/launcher3/widget/picker/WidgetsListItemAnimator.java
@@ -0,0 +1,60 @@
+/*
+ * Copyright (C) 2024 The Android Open Source Project
+ *
+ * Licensed under the Apache License, Version 2.0 (the "License");
+ * you may not use this file except in compliance with the License.
+ * You may obtain a copy of the License at
+ *
+ *      http://www.apache.org/licenses/LICENSE-2.0
+ *
+ * Unless required by applicable law or agreed to in writing, software
+ * distributed under the License is distributed on an "AS IS" BASIS,
+ * WITHOUT WARRANTIES OR CONDITIONS OF ANY KIND, either express or implied.
+ * See the License for the specific language governing permissions and
+ * limitations under the License.
+ */
+
+package com.android.launcher3.widget.picker;
+
+import static com.android.launcher3.widget.picker.WidgetsListAdapter.VIEW_TYPE_WIDGETS_LIST;
+
+import androidx.recyclerview.widget.DefaultItemAnimator;
+import androidx.recyclerview.widget.RecyclerView;
+
+public class WidgetsListItemAnimator extends DefaultItemAnimator {
+    public static final int CHANGE_DURATION_MS = 90;
+    public static final int MOVE_DURATION_MS = 90;
+    public static final int ADD_DURATION_MS = 120;
+
+    public WidgetsListItemAnimator() {
+        super();
+
+        // Disable change animations because it disrupts the item focus upon adapter item
+        // change.
+        setSupportsChangeAnimations(false);
+        // Make the moves a bit faster, so that the amount of time for which user sees the
+        // bottom-sheet background before "add" animation starts is less making it smoother.
+        setChangeDuration(CHANGE_DURATION_MS);
+        setMoveDuration(MOVE_DURATION_MS);
+        setAddDuration(ADD_DURATION_MS);
+    }
+    @Override
+    public boolean animateChange(RecyclerView.ViewHolder oldHolder,
+            RecyclerView.ViewHolder newHolder, int fromLeft, int fromTop, int toLeft,
+            int toTop) {
+        // As we expand an item, the content / widgets list that appears (with add
+        // event) also gets change events as its previews load asynchronously. The
+        // super implementation of animateChange cancels the animations on it - breaking
+        // the "add animation". Instead, here, we skip "change" animation for content
+        // list - because we want it to either appear or disappear. And, the previews
+        // themselves have their own animation when loaded, so, we don't need change
+        // animations for them anyway. Below, we do-nothing.
+        if (oldHolder.getItemViewType() == VIEW_TYPE_WIDGETS_LIST) {
+            dispatchChangeStarting(oldHolder, true);
+            dispatchChangeFinished(oldHolder, true);
+            return true;
+        }
+        return super.animateChange(oldHolder, newHolder, fromLeft, fromTop, toLeft,
+                toTop);
+    }
+}
